Output 0624b19f86e284595ae622722c609306cf2fb403796bb991872d31a71b0ddb3a:1

value
251242
script pubkey
OP_0 OP_PUSHBYTES_20 b637f9e11b9d562cba9738d01deda53d42277014
address
bc1qkcmlncgmn4tzew5h8rgpmmd984pzwuq5j05pw7
transaction
0624b19f86e284595ae622722c609306cf2fb403796bb991872d31a71b0ddb3a
confirmations
101677
spent
true